Compact Globe-Shaped Plants Perfect for Edging and Containers
Spicy Globe Basil features tiny aromatic leaves on naturally compact, globe-shaped plants reaching 8-12 inches. Forms a perfect ball without pinching, ideal for edging, borders, and small containers. Produces abundant small leaves with mild, sweet flavor throughout the season. Prefers full sun, warm weather, and consistent moisture. Use fresh leaves in salads, garnishes, and light dishes.

Growing Tips
Plant in full sun in well-drained soil after all danger of frost has passed. Space plants 8-12 inches apart. Water regularly to keep soil consistently moist but not waterlogged. No pinching required as plants naturally form globe shape. Harvest leaves as needed throughout the season. Bring indoors before first frost or treat as an annual.
Container Size: 4" Pot Mature Size: 8-12" tall and wide Light: Full sun Water: Moderate, keep consistently moist Hardiness: Annual, frost sensitive Special Feature: Compact globe shape, no pinching required, ornamental
